Type
ORACLE
Validation date
2023-05-24 12:16: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.05868,
    "usd": 0.06322
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001CE747A43716CB00CB122D7F4C9D0D05A51F3A30BD654091693D72C427213D9E3

Previous signature

81D8AC37A6FA21FD21887EA0A01CBEB146FB211DDC9AF1829379D53C7A76AF216280AF75A2264514744A51A165F61EC92CD0CA31B196148604ECD8202E7C3305

Origin signature

3046022100E992FB6BCA5AECFC93B5B5AE215496CE4327CC6074D45180DB468373FAA436EA0221009EEC3FBA1B0D0CF1776EF28737FBF7149599CB2266F49F6C69F93CA3703B7062

Proof of work

010104AB672F1E69B064D192819F1797C1926F158DBA8F3924AC732B4C4D70D0C8EA0A0D6506E5896C9C2524D2BE26CB5016287E1816A597C408008BA36FCB154A7765

Proof of integrity

000047FAA9449381ED588C4E2950708EEE950EFF760D169B504867A3DC5172E038

Coordinator signature

9944E3DF540CF347D3EF78F87BC381A2CF8AB03214D075EAF557166C0AC051C61021BDF16F7F6B3C7FE27C420ED1B360C6A0BB9C2A86EE1109EE50FB01617C06

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

E068FFF8B14C228C69F4DBFA16E3A59E481AA7C771CB5DCA4BE600E6250DEF984E5B4E46386FE40D6E6E15C840C2C69F648440C275CB8854BD038CFFD6A36E0A

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

585797541CCB67D3C13DA726C4574FB1BA765F06877862A287111F6EA125A6608775E1C38C8C14E04CCA834D2835D57EA7B502BB4C45D9DA8E466034690A7908